flickr image Wanted - Have you seen Ahmed Farrah? (Detectives investigating the murder of 21-year-old Kavan Brissett are appealing to find the man pictured. 

Ahmed Farrah, 29, who is also known as Reggie, is wanted in connection to Mr Brissett’s murder, as the investigation progresses. 

Mr Brissett was stabbed once in the chest on Tuesday 14 August, near to Langsett Walk, Sheffield. He died in hospital four days later on Saturday 18 August as a result of his injuries. 

Detective Chief Inspector Jude Ashmore, the Senior Investigating Officer, said: “Efforts to find and arrest Farrah, who is known to frequent the Broomhall area of Sheffield, have been ongoing but so far we haven’t been able to locate him. 

“I’d now like to ask for your help – if you know where he is, or have seen or spoken to him recently, then please contact us. If you do see him, do not approach him but instead call 999 straight away. 

“I’d also like to remind anyone who is letting Farrah stay with them, or helping him to evade arrest by any means, that you are committing a criminal offence which could result in prosecution. 

“Farrah knows he is wanted and is deliberately avoiding police and I’d ask anyone who has any information, and Farrah himself, to think about Kavan’s family and the pain they are suffering. Do the right thing and contact police.” 

If you see Farrah, please call 999. If you have any other information as to where he might be, please call either 101 or the incident room to speak to detectives directly on 01709 443507. 

You can also speak to Crimestoppers on 0800 555111. Please quote incident number 827 of 14 August 2018 when passing on information.

flickr image Wanted - John Eric Wells, South Yorkshire (Officers in South Yorkshire Police's Major Crime team are asking for your help to find wanted man John Eric Wells.

Wells is also believed to go by the names Howard Walmsley and Howard Hemmings.

The 61-year-old, who is originally from South Yorkshire, is wanted in connection with three high value romance frauds, during which three victims lost money totalling more than £400,000. 

The offences are reported to have taken place from September 2014 onwards. The victims lived in locations across the UK including Doncaster, Sussex and London.

Police would like to hear from anyone who has seen or spoken to Wells recently, or has information which may help officers with their enquiries. It is possible Wells is currently living outside the UK. 

If you see him, or you have any information which may help, please call South Yorkshire Police on 101 quoting investigation number A54532/17. )

A rainy day of action in Barnsley 
There will be an increased police presence across Barnsley today, Thursday 26 September as Operation Duxford returns to the town, dedicated to tackling the issues that matter most to local communities.
Officers have not been discouraged by the weather as they have set off across the district following a multi-agency briefing at Churchfields Police Station.
There are a range of activities taking place throughout the day and into the evening in partnership with South Yorkshire Fire and Rescue, Barnsley Council and other agencies as Chief Superintendent Scott Green explains: “Today is about taking action following feedback from our communities, and tackling the issues that matter to you the most.
“This early in the operation, we cannot give too much detail but I am hoping that later today we can share positive results with you of those arrested, items recovered and action taken.
“If you see our officers while you are out and about, stop and say hello.”
Results will be shared on the SYP social media accounts and local Barnsley NHP accounts throughout the day.
